摘要
A method for preparing a phenylpropanoid amid compound is provided to mass-product the phenylpropanoid amid compound, which has various pharmacological activities such as anti-bacterial, anti-oxidative, and bone formation promoting activity, such as coumaroylserotonin, feruloylserotonin, and caffeoylserotonin conveniently and economically using methanol as an elicitor. A biosynthesis inducer of phenylpropanoid amide compounds in plants or an expression inducer of serotonin hydroxycinnamoyl transferase(SHT) or tryptophane decarboxylase(TDC) in the plants comprises methanol as an elicitor. To biosynthesize phenylpropanoid amide compounds in a plant, the plant is treated with methanol. To induce expression of SHT or TDC in a plant, the plant is treated with methanol. Further, a concentration of the used methanol is 0.5 to 1.0%.
